Microsoft’s Surface app updates for Windows 11, 10, and 8.1 devices with new improvements – onmsft.com

Brad Stephenson Brad Stephenson
October 7, 2021
1 min read

The official Surface app updated this week for devices running Windows 8.1, Windows 10, and Windows 11.

This latest app update added support for 36 languages and smart charging in addition to making some minor design refinements to improve the user experience.

Here’s the full release notes:

In the October 2021 update to the Surface app, we’ve added several new features and improvements for our users:

  1. An updated user experience that complements the premium hardware experience for Surface
  2. Support for Surface accessories, including Surface audio devices, pen, and docks
  3. Support for features, like Smart charging, on devices that support it
  4. New promotions for eligible Surface devices
  5. Support for 36 languages

The Surface app is a bit of an unusual Windows app as it’s apparently designed to assist in the management of Microsoft Surface devices but very few settings and options actually exist within it. It’s honestly not uncommon for a Surface owner to use their device for a year or so before even becoming aware that the app exists.
